技术文摘
Oracle数据库中字段的创建与管理方法
2025-01-15 00:33:33 小编
Oracle数据库中字段的创建与管理方法
在当今数字化时代,数据管理至关重要,而Oracle数据库作为强大的关系型数据库管理系统,其字段的创建与管理是数据库管理员和开发人员必须掌握的技能。
创建字段是构建数据库表结构的基础步骤。在Oracle中,使用CREATE TABLE语句来创建表并定义字段。例如,要创建一个存储员工信息的表,可使用如下语句:
CREATE TABLE employees (
employee_id NUMBER(10) PRIMARY KEY,
first_name VARCHAR2(50),
last_name VARCHAR2(50),
salary NUMBER(8, 2)
);
在这个例子中,定义了“employee_id”作为主键,类型为数值型且长度为10位;“first_name”和“last_name”是字符串类型,最大长度为50;“salary”也是数值型,总长度8位,保留两位小数。准确选择字段类型对于数据存储和后续操作的性能和准确性都至关重要。
字段管理涵盖多个方面,其中字段修改是常见操作。如果需要增加一个新字段,比如员工的电子邮箱地址,可以使用ALTER TABLE语句:
ALTER TABLE employees
ADD email VARCHAR2(100);
若要修改现有字段的属性,例如增加“salary”字段的长度,可以这样做:
ALTER TABLE employees
MODIFY salary NUMBER(10, 2);
而删除字段时,同样使用ALTER TABLE语句:
ALTER TABLE employees
DROP COLUMN email;
合理的字段重命名操作能让数据库结构更加清晰。使用RENAME COLUMN子句可以实现这一点,例如将“first_name”重命名为“given_name”:
ALTER TABLE employees
RENAME COLUMN first_name TO given_name;
索引的创建与字段管理紧密相关。合适的索引可以显著提升查询性能。对于“employees”表的“last_name”字段,为了加快按姓氏查询员工的速度,可以创建索引:
CREATE INDEX idx_last_name ON employees(last_name);
通过掌握Oracle数据库中字段的创建与管理方法,能够构建高效、稳定的数据库结构,为企业的数据处理和业务运营提供坚实的基础保障。无论是小型项目还是大型企业级应用,这些技能都是数据库管理与开发不可或缺的关键要素。
- Python with语句打开文件时优雅处理文件不存在情况的方法
- tqdm进度条与print()函数冲突时的调试方法
- Python避免tqdm进度条与print函数冲突的方法
- Python with语句打开文件 如何创建不存在的文件或目录
- Python列表子列表合并时值改变原因
- Python 中修改子列表为何会影响父列表
- 请你提供更具体的原标题内容呀,仅“或”这个字难以有效改写得出符合需求的新标题 。
- 或者
- Python列表合并后值变化却无赋值操作,原因何在
- Python列表合并时修改子列表改变原始列表的原因
- Python列表合并后值改变探究:未赋值列表为何也会变动?
- API返回空值的原因
- API 返回空值但 requests 库无报错时怎样排查故障
- 获取Pydantic模型字段max_length值的方法
- 通过代码获取Pydantic模型字段max_length值的方法